The “No Wires” Trick: Add a Second Light Switch Anywhere Description (SEO-optimised with keywords + hashtags) Want a second light switch without chasing walls, running cables, or making mess? In this real-world install I fit a kinetic wireless switch (battery-free) with a compact Wi-Fi dimmer relay/receiver behind the existing one-way switch. We keep the original switch, add a wireless two-way partner, and enable app control + dimming—all with no new wiring.
